Jester Park Campground

  • Specialty: Spacious, well-maintained campsites with access to a plethora of outdoor activities
  • Ambiance: Nestled around the picturesque Saylorville Lake, Jester Park offers a perfect blend of tranquility and adventure, making it a prime spot for families and nature lovers alike
  • Highlights: This expansive campground boasts a mix of wooded and open sites, providing a perfect setting for both tents and RVs. Visitors can enjoy hiking, fishing, and wildlife watching. The park also features a nature center that hosts educational programs, making it a great option for families with children. Plus, don't miss out on the beautiful sunsets over the lake!
  • Ideal for: Families and outdoor enthusiasts looking for a wide range of activities in a natural setting

Saylorville Lake - Cherry Glen Campground

  • Specialty: Lakefront camping with a variety of recreational options
  • Ambiance: A vibrant atmosphere with a lively community vibe, perfect for both relaxation and socializing
  • Highlights: Located along the shores of Saylorville Lake, the Cherry Glen Campground is a hotspot for both fishing and water sports. The well-equipped campsites have access to amenities such as picnic areas, showers, and playgrounds. Bring your kayak or paddleboard, or simply enjoy the beach area. The natural beauty surrounding the lake pairs perfectly with evening campfires under the stars.
  • Ideal for: Water enthusiasts and campers looking for a fun and active outdoor experience

Ledges State Park

  • Specialty: Scenic hiking trails and stunning rock formations
  • Ambiance: A serene and natural environment, offering a retreat into the beauty of Iowa's rugged terrain
  • Highlights: Renowned for its breathtaking landscapes, Ledges State Park features towering cliffs and scenic water vistas. The park's campsites are snugly nestled amidst the trees, providing a calm refuge. Explore the extensive trails that wind through colorful native flora and enjoy the stunning views from the cliff tops. For those interested in photography, the early morning light creates magical scenes!
  • Ideal for: Nature lovers and hikers seeking a picturesque and peaceful camping experience
